Little Rock Holds Five-Stroke Lead in OVC Championship After Bumpy Second Round
Little Rock maintains a five-stroke lead heading into the final round of the OVC Championship at Tunica National despite a challenging second round marked by a 12-over finish on the back nine.
By the Numbers- Little Rock carded a 305 (17-over) in the second round, just three strokes higher than their opening round.
- Second-place Morehead State closed the gap, finishing at 301 (13-over), trimming Little Rock's lead from nine strokes to five.
- Anna Dawson leads the individual leaderboard at 3-over 147, with Eleonore Aernouts in second at 6-over 150.
Little Rock faced challenges on the back nine with 10 bogeys and three double bogeys, impacting their lead.
State of Play- Little Rock maintains the lead despite increased pressure from Morehead State.
- The top three positions in the tournament remain unchanged, with Western Illinois holding third place.
Wednesday's final round tee times have been adjusted earlier by 30 minutes due to potential inclement weather.
